Job Title: Refrigeration Technician
Job Description
We are seeking a skilled Refrigeration Technician with a strong understanding of refrigeration systems, including low, medium, and high-temperature systems. The ideal candidate will possess a certified refrigerant recovery card (EPC cert) and have hands-on experience with brazing, silver soldering, and soft soldering, as well as pipe fitting, insulating, and leak testing.
ResponsibilitiesCollaborate with production and engineering teams to ensure system specifications are met.Read and comprehend process flow and engineering schematics.Layout, cut, mount, and connect process piping using soldering and brazing methods.Fill process loops with specified gases or fluids.Cut, thread, and connect pipe to functional components and water or power systems on premises.Insulate piping, heaters, and various other system components.Essential SkillsProficiency in brazing, pipe fitting, soldering, and leak testing.Experience with refrigeration and HVAC systems.Ability to read electrical schematics and mechanical blueprints.Strong verbal and written communication skills.Mastery of refrigeration cycles, including identifying components, diagnosing, and correcting circuit problems.Experience with refrigeration recovery, evacuation, and charging, as well as installation and sizing of refrigerant piping.Additional Skills & QualificationsFamiliarity with basic hand tools and power tools.Mechanical inclination and knowledge of machines and tools, including their designs, uses, repair, and maintenance.5-10 years of experience in commercial HVAC.Refrigeration Certification and EPA Certification.Ability to work independently, with direction, and in groups.Willingness to grow and learn.Why Work Here?
